Last year we celebrated National Bourbon Heritage month and we are here to do it again. See the fun from last year here: TSC Celebrates Bourbon Heritage Month Sept. 2021

This year once again the goal is to have a sip of bourbon each night ideally a different bourbon if possible and compare the nuances as you work your way through the month.

The only caveat is it must be bourbon; for that I show you the definition of bourbon pay attention to #1 although the others are just as relevant.

1661981556285.png

Now within the bourbon world we have a lot of nuances is it straight, bottled in bond, batched, single barrel, barrel proof, barrel strength?

It does not matter as long as it is indeed bourbon.

All are welcome neat drinker, over ice, a splash of water, or even cocktails.

As an aside...I was listening to some programing yesterday with a local whiskey seller. Basically he said that the Whiskey/Bourbon market has slowed down quite a bit as of late. Most likely because of the economy and such. But this guys was saying that it is easier to find some whiskeys that are normally hard to find. He said it still might not be super easy...but you chances are better now than they have been.

Also, if you are looking for that hard to find whiskey...September - November is usually when the rare whiskeys get released.
